    The Sunday Mail - FREE Horrible Science Book

    DON'T miss today's Sunday Mail to start collecting your fantastic FREE Horrible Science books!

    We’re giving you the chance to pick up SEVEN brilliant books celebrating science with the squishy bits left in, worth £5.99 each.

    Explore the explosive world of Horrible Science with our cracking collection featuring:

    [STRIKE]Sat 6 Oct - Wasted World[/STRIKE]
    Sun 7 Oct - Blood, Bones & Body Bits
    Mon 8 Oct - Evil Inventions
    Tue 9 Oct - Really Rotten Experiments
    Wed 10 Oct - Nasty Nature
    Thu 11 Oct - Space, Stars & Slimy Aliens
    Fri 12 Oct – Ugly Bugs


    Each book is worth £5.99, so don’t miss out.

    To get your hands on the books you must buy each paper and take the token on the page to your nearest McColl's, RS McColl or Nisa where you can collect the book.
